Defence Ministry Supports Horse Racing for Youth Engagement

The Ministry of Defence has pledged full support for horse racing in Nigeria as a strategy to engage youth and mitigate restiveness across the country. During a visit on Thursday, Tajudeen Dantata, the chairman of the Horse Racing Federation of Nigeria (HRFN), received the ministry's backing.
Dantata emphasized the cultural significance of horse racing, describing it as central to human development and social cohesion. The initiative aims to revive Nigeria's horse culture and provide employment opportunities, with each horse engaging 12 to 15 individuals.
The Minister of Defence highlighted the importance of security coordination during events, given the ministry's mandate to promote peace and unity. Dantata also noted the historical relevance of horses within military traditions, including ceremonial parades.
The ministry's commitment is seen as a strategic move to ensure security during horse racing events and to support youth engagement in national security efforts.
